Dear executive team,

Attached is the finance team's assessment of the requested increase for the Orison platform build. The request covers three additional engineers, extended hosting capacity, and a contingency of 6%. Payback is modelled at nineteen months under conservative adoption assumptions, with sensitivity analysis included. We recommend approval with quarterly gate reviews. Questions welcome before Thursday's session. The confidential note below outlines the business plans this budget supports.

confidential, kagup-bafog: Fraaxax Group is in early talks to buy Soroxox Group for about $343.8 million. The Olidor launch date is June 14, and nothing goes to the press before then. Legal wants the Aldmirek Logistics term sheet signed before July 23.

## Changelog — Font vendoring defaults changed

As of this release, the Bracken UI build no longer fetches third-party fonts at build time. All typefaces used by the Lanternwell suite are now vendored into the repo under a dedicated assets directory, and the fetch step is skipped by default. If you're onboarding, nothing to install — the fonts travel with the checkout. The build flags controlling this behavior are listed below.

settings of hadup-yafog:
LAMAEL_PIN=3761
LAMAEL_TENANT=istmir
LAMAEL_METRICS_HOST=metrics.lamael.plorvasys.test
LAMAEL_SEAL=seal_8ea68500
LAMAEL_STANDBY_TEAM=fraok

Ticket PRX-1042: The Seatwell dynamic-pricing experiment (variant B) is applying the matinee discount to evening shows in the Haldane venue group. Pricing service logs show the experiment flag resolving correctly, but the discount rule cache was seeded before the flag flipped. Please hold the rollout until cache invalidation lands. For verification against the staging deploy, the relevant build token is recorded directly beneath this entry.

session token of tajef-bageg = htk21_5d90d574934f3ccae6437